Struct DynamicSet
pub struct DynamicSet { /* private fields */ }Expand description
An unordered set of reflected values.
Implementations§
§impl DynamicSet
impl DynamicSet
pub fn set_represented_type(
&mut self,
represented_type: Option<&'static TypeInfo>,
)
pub fn set_represented_type( &mut self, represented_type: Option<&'static TypeInfo>, )
Sets the type to be represented by this DynamicSet.
§Panics
Panics if the given type is not a TypeInfo::Set.
